What is the current population of Summersville?

Based on the latest 2024 data from the US census, the current population of Summersville is 469. Summersville, Missouri is the 13,446th largest city in the US.

What was the peak population of Summersville?

The peak population of Summersville was in 1990, when its population was 571. In 1990, Summersville was the 12,404th largest city in the US; now its fallen to the 13,446th largest city in the US. Summersville is currently 17.9% smaller than it was in 1990.

How quickly is Summersville shrinking?

Summersville has shrunk 13.7% since the year 2000. Summersville, Missouri's growth is below average. 64% of similarly sized cities are growing faster since 2000.

What is the voting age population of Summersville, Missouri?

The total voting age population of Summersville, Missouri, meaning US citizens 18 or older, is 388. The voting age population is 45.4% male and 54.6% female.

What percentage of Summersville, Missouri residents are senior citizens?

According to the latest census statistics, 18.8% of the residents of Summersville are 65 or older.

What are the racial demographics of Summersville, Missouri?

The racial demographics of Summersville are 90.7% White, 8.0% Black and 1.4% Asian.

What percentage of Summersville, Missouri residents are below the poverty line?

In Summersville, 35.1% of residents have an income below the poverty line, and the child poverty rate is 38.6%. On a per-household basis, 28.1% of families are below the poverty line in Summersville.

What percentage of Summersville, Missouri residents are in the labor force?

Among those aged 16 and older, 46.8% of Summersville residents are in the labor force.

What are the education levels among Summersville, Missouri residents?

Among the adult population 25 years old and over, 86.8% of Summersville residents have at least a high school degree or equivalent, 16.9% have a bachelor's degree and 4.6% have a graduate or professional degree.

What percentage of Summersville, Missouri residents speak a non-English language at home?

Among Summersville residents aged 5 and older, 1.5% of them speak a non-English language at home. Broken down by language: 0.0% of residents speak Spanish at home, 0.0% speak an Indo-European language, and 1.5% speak an Asian language.

What is the unemployment rate in Summersville, Missouri?

The unemployment rate in Summersville is 4.3%, which is calculated among residents aged 16 or older who are in the labor force.

What percentage of Summersville, Missouri residents work for the government?

In Summersville, 25.0% of the residents in the non-military labor force are employed by the local, state and federal government.

What is the median income in Summersville, Missouri?

The median household income in Summersville is $23,125.

What percentage of housing units are owner-occupied in Summersville, Missouri?

In Summersville, 54.3% of housing units are occupied by their owners.

What percentage of housing units are rented in Summersville, Missouri?

Renters occupy 45.7% of housing units in Summersville.

What percentage of Summersville, Missouri housing units were built before 1940?

Of all the housing units in Summersville, 16.1% of them were build before 1940.

What percentage of Summersville, Missouri housing units were built after 2000?

In Summersville, 13.9% of the total housing units were built after the year 2000.

What is the median monthly rent in Summersville, Missouri?

The median gross monthly rent payment for renters in Summersville is $536.

What percentage of households in Summersville, Missouri have broadband internet?

In Summersville, 55.7% of households have an active broadband internet connection.
